Blower motor?
 
I was driving home Yesterday from Wheeling and I was noticing that the A/C blower was making alot of noise but not putting out alot of air flow. Is there a cab filter in these trucks like the Chevs do? I didn't sound like there was anything broken just loud. I was Hauling a truck camper and towing a Jeep on a trailer if that makes a diffrence.

Heath 04-30-2007 11:34 AM

I don't show a cabin filter in my books. Wish they did though.

Uncle Bubba 04-30-2007 11:48 AM

You can get a cab filter through Geno's but they don't come factory with one. Sounds like your losing your blower motor. Bearings are probably going out. Some folks drill a little hole in the housing and shoot some WD40 in there and it may prolong the replacement. Once they put enough drag on the motor then it will also blow the resistor, that's another $50 to add on. I went through 3 resistors before I finally figured out that the fan was bad.

sounds like you have a blockage between the fan and the outlets....does the air comming out smell like mouse poo?got a critter nested up in there?

Uncle Bubba 04-30-2007 01:17 PM

It's an easy project to pull the fan and check it all out. Just a couple of screws and unplug the wire bundle. This would also give you some room to check for blockages.
